We propose to homogeneously cover the 2 deg**2 contiguous area of the XMM/ COSMOS field to a sensitivity level of 5 x 10**(-16) cgs in the 0.5-2.0 keV energy band. By doubling the existing exposure time the number of X-ray selected AGN increases from 1500 to 3000. In combination with the already existing multiwavelength coverage (e.g., HST ACS, Subaru images) and with the up-coming VLT VIMOS and Magellan IMACS spectroscopy we will be able to study the formation and evolution of supermassive black holes, the evolution of the spatial distribution and the correlation with galaxy morphology and evolution.
